BIBER model series
Depending on the size of the component and the amount of chamfering work to be done, different system layouts are available. The ecoBIBER is the entry-level model of our bevel cutting robots, in which the robot is mounted on a plinth fixed to the hall floor and can work in the operating area that lies within its reach.
The profiBIBER, the most widely used BIBER system, has the cutting robot mounted on an in front console that moves on a linear unit. The autoBIBER is the most complex version of the BIBER system. As the profiBIBER, a linear unit ensures a large working area. However, the autoBIBER is additionally equipped with a shuttle table system with a belt conveyor and a soundproof enclosure.
ecoBIBER
- Cutting robot securely mounted on a plinth on the hall floor
- Working area limited by range of the robot
- One work station, so that cutting and loading/unloading must take place alternately
- Designed for small to medium sized components
- Low space requirement due to compact size
profiBIBER
- Cutting robot is placed on a console, which can be moved on a linear unit
- One large work area or several smaller work stations due to sliding partition wall system
- Cutting and loading/unloading can be done at the same time
- Designed for small, medium and large components, depending on table size
- Can be combined with a soundproofed operator control panel
autoBIBER
- Cutting robot is located on a console, which can be moved on a linear unit
- Complete cutting area is inside a soundproof cabin to protect operators from noise
- Loading and unloading takes place outside the cabin while the robot is cutting
- Shuttle table with automatic slag discharge for easy handling and maximum efficiency
